Other structures are excluded from coverage under the HO-3
when they are:


Smaller than 100 square feet or larger than 1,000 square feet
Smaller than 100 square feet or larger than 500 square feet
Used for storage purposes
Used for business purposes
Used for business purposes is correct.
EXPLANATION:
When the other structures are used for business purposes they
are not covered under the homeowner form. This structure and
its contents could be covered under a commercial property
policy. An exception would be a detached structure used to
store business property of a non-flammable, non-gaseous
nature.

Under Workers Compensation rules, for an employee to
receive Temporary Disability Compensation for the first three
(3) days of his disability, his disability period must extend:
Answer Choices: Select the Correct Answer
21 days
30 days
45 days
60 days
21 days is correct.
EXPLANATION:
Benefits are retroactive to the day of the injury if the disability
lasts 21 days.

,Under the conditions section of the BOP, which of the
following would not be considered vacant?
Answer Choices: Select the Correct Answer
A 100 unit apartment building of which 70 units are not
rented
An office building containing two empty units and these two
empty suites represent 25% of the total floor space.
A mercantile building with a print shop on the ground floor
but the second and third floors are not being utilized
A new building which has not been rented out at all
An office building containing two empty units and these two
empty suites represent 25% of the total floor space. is correct.
EXPLANATION:
A building is considered vacant when 65% or more of the
total floor space is not being utilized or rented out. The office
building with two empty suites is only 25% vacant.
